A driver is software that allows an operating system (like Windows) to communicate with a specific hardware component (like a graphics card). A BIOS, on the other hand, is stored on a ROM (Read-Only Memory) chip on the motherboard. It is the first code that runs when you power on a PC, responsible for initializing hardware, performing the Power-On Self-Test (POST), and ultimately booting the operating system from a drive.
